About the 🪁 Kite emoji
The 🪁 Kite emoji is part of the Activities category and the game group on DBEmoji. Shortcodes such as :kite:, :fly:, and :soar: resolve to this emoji on platforms like Slack, Discord, and GitHub.
Kite (Unicode codepoint U+1FA81) an activities emoji called Kite.. 🪁, formally named "kite", carries U+1FA81 as its codepoint sequence. 🪁 animates sports updates, game-night invites, hobby posts, and competition recaps. Its Unicode codepoint sequence is U+1FA81 (1FA81). It joined the Unicode standard in version 12.0 and shipped on iOS from version 13.0 onward. Common shortcodes: :kite:, :fly:, :soar:. Visually, the dominant palette leans blue based on Twemoji pixel analysis. It shows up under game, fly, kite, and soar tag views.
